Basic information Supplier

[(1-methyl-1H-pyrrol-2-yl)methyl](prop-2-en-1-yl)amine hydrochloride

Basic information Supplier
1050075-95-0 Basic informationMore

Browse by Nationality 1050075-95-0 Suppliers >Global suppliers

Please select the suppliers
Recommend You Select Member Companies